WebSnakebite envenoming is a neglected tropical disease (NTD) that results from the injection of snake venom of a venomous snake into animals and humans. In Africa (mainly in sub-Saharan Africa), over 100,000 envenomings and over 10,000 deaths per annum from snakebite have been reported. WebIf you’re bitten by a snake, your symptoms will differ depending on which type of bite it is. If you suffer a dry snake bite, you’ll likely just have swelling and redness around the area of the bite. But if you’re bitten by a venomous snake, you’ll have more widespread symptoms, which commonly include: Bite marks on your skin. Web5 de ago. de 2024 · As a non-venomous snake, the Gopher has a single anal plate. The snake also has keeled scales on its body. You can observe 27-37 rows of scales in the midsection of the Gopher snake's body.
